Transaction 58106d71b05a47f348e7322bc5285c245643990da4e7c7cc7aee16716cdfa60a
1 Input
1 Output
-
58106d71b05a47f348e7322bc5285c245643990da4e7c7cc7aee16716cdfa60a:0
- value
- 547181
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b927b7c9c2afbab5eae1852e3f911e65674e1c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14yPY2HjGyoU7QEf6irTpBAe2Qtneizr6a